About notebook refurbished

A refurbished notebook laptop is a used or pre-owned laptop that has been restored to a fully functional, like-new condition. The refurbishment process typically involves diagnosing and repairing any hardware issues, cleaning the device inside and out, and reinstalling the operating system to ensure optimal performance. These refurbished laptops are a cost-effective and sustainable alternative to buying new, allowing budget-conscious buyers to acquire high-quality laptops at a lower price point. Moreover, by giving a second life to these devices, the refurbishing process helps reduce electronic waste and minimize the environmental impact of consumer electronics.

Benefits of refurbished notebook laptops

Refurbished notebook laptops offer several advantages, making them a compelling choice for a wide range of users. One of the primary benefits is cost savings. Refurbished laptops are typically priced lower than their brand-new counterparts, allowing budget-conscious individuals, students, and small businesses to access reliable computing devices without breaking the bank. Moreover, by opting for a refurbished notebook laptop, buyers can often afford higher-end models or premium brands that may have been out of reach at the original retail price. This affordability makes refurbished laptops a popular choice for students looking for a budget-friendly option for schoolwork, professionals in need of a secondary device, or individuals seeking a cost-effective solution for everyday computing.

Another benefit of refurbished notebook laptops is environmental sustainability. By extending the useful life of these devices through refurbishment, fewer laptops end up in landfills, reducing electronic waste and the associated environmental impact. This approach aligns with the principles of the circular economy, where products are reused, repaired, and recycled to minimize resource consumption and waste generation. In addition to the cost savings and environmental benefits, refurbished notebook laptops are also a practical choice for individuals and businesses seeking to minimize their carbon footprint and contribute to a more sustainable future.

Common types of refurbished notebook laptops

A refurbished laptop can offer the same performance as a new one, but at a much lower price. Some of the most common types of refurbished notebook laptops include refurbished notebook computers, which are laptops that have been returned to the manufacturer or retailer due to defects or other issues. These laptops are then repaired and tested to ensure they meet the manufacturer's standards before being resold as refurbished. On the other hand, second-hand notebook laptops are pre-owned laptops that are sold directly by the previous owner. These laptops may not undergo the same refurbishment process as manufacturer-refurbished devices, but they are often inspected and tested to ensure they are in working condition. While the term "second-hand" is often used interchangeably with "used," some sellers may differentiate between the two to indicate the condition of the laptop and the extent of any refurbishment or testing that has been performed. For instance, a "used notebook laptop" may simply refer to a pre-owned device, while a "second-hand notebook laptop" could imply that the laptop has been inspected or tested before being sold.
